Skip to main content
pinterest pinterest icon print print icon

Spinach and Mushroom Quiche

A versatile, egg-free recipe that can be made with a tofu batter or a chickpea flour batter, with or without the crust, and served hot or cold.

  • Author: Dr. Rosane Oliveira
  • Prep Time: 20 minutes
  • Cook Time: 30-45 minutes
  • Total Time: 50-65 minutes
  • Yield: 6 1x
Print Recipe



  • 1 cup flour, oat or buckwheat
  • 1 cup almonds, ground into flour
  • 1 tsp parsley, dry
  • 1 tsp oregano, dry
  • 3 tbsp aquafaba
  • 12 1/2 tbsp water, as needed

Tofu Batter

  • 1 pound tofu, extra firm, pressed
  • 1/4 cup nutritional yeast
  • 1/4 cup cornstarch
  • 1 tbsp lemon juice, freshly squeezed
  • 1 tsp onion powder
  • 1 tsp garlic powder
  • 1/2 tsp turmeric, ground
  • 1/4 tsp red pepper flakes

Chickpea Flour Batter

  • 1 1/2 cups chickpea flour
  • 1 cup water
  • 1 tbsp black salt (optional)
  • 1/2 cup applesauce, unsweetened


  • 1 cup onion, chopped
  • 1 cup mushrooms, chopped
  • 2 cups baby spinach, fresh, chopped
  • 2 tsp garlic, fresh, finely chopped
  • Tomatoes, chopped (optional)
  • Red bell peppers, chopped (optional)
  • Nutritional yeast (optional)



  1. Preheat oven to 350°F.
  2. Add dry ingredients to bowl and stir.
  3. Add in aquafaba and mix until combined. Add water as needed until the dough sticks together when you press it with your fingertips.
  4. Crumble the dough over a pie pan, then press it down evenly, starting in the middle and working your way out.
  5. With a fork, poke a few holes to allow air to escape as it bakes.
  6. As the batter and filling are prepared, bake the crust for 12-15 minutes or until lightly golden.


  1. If using the Tofu Batter, combine all ingredients in a food processor and blend until smooth and creamy. Transfer to a bowl.
  2. If using the Chickpea Flour Batter, add all ingredients to a bowl and whisk until well combined.


  1. Add onions and mushrooms to a nonstick skillet and cook over medium heat for about 10 minutes, or until mushrooms have released most of their moisture.
  2. Add in spinach and garlic and cook for 3 minutes.
  3. If desired, tomatoes, red bell peppers and/or nutritional yeast may be added to the batter at this time.
  4. Transfer batter to the baked pie crust and sprinkle with nutritional yeast, if desired, for a cheese-flavored top. You may also garnish with tomato and/or bell pepper slices.
  5. Bake 30-45 minutes or until golden brown and firm.
  6. Remove from oven and let cool 10-20 minutes before cutting.

Notes: Aquafaba is the viscous liquid in which canned legumes (e.g. chickpeas) have been cooked. Three tablespoons are equal to one egg or one egg white. Black salt is optional but it will give the traditional ‘egg’ smell and taste to the quiche. This recipe can also be made as a crustless quiche. Simply prepare the batter and filling then pour directly into a silicone or glass baking pan.

Did you make this recipe?

Share a photo and tag us @pblifeorg or use #mypblife — we can't wait to see what you've made!

Rosane Oliveira, DVM, PhD

President & CEO, Plant-Based Life Foundation | Dr. Rosane Oliveira combines a lifelong passion for nutrition with 25 years of genetics research to create programs that help people develop healthy habits on their journey towards a more plant-based lifestyle. She is a Visiting Clinical Professor in Public Health Sciences and was the founding director of the first Integrative Medicine program at the UC Davis School of Medicine. She completed her postgraduate studies in Brazil and did her postdoctoral training in immunogenetics and functional genomics at the University of Illinois at Urbana-Champaign.